    Abstract : Brain aging is a heterogeneous phenomenon, and this thesis illustrates how the course of aging can vary within individuals over time and between individuals as a function of age, sex, and genetic variability. We used two contrasts from magnetic resonance imaging (MRI), namely spin-lattice T1-weighted imaging, and quantitative susceptibility mapping (QSM) from gradient-echo images, to picture the aging brain, by means of morphometric measures and brain-iron concentrations.     Abstract : The purpose of the present thesis was to test and contrast hypotheses about the cognitive conditions that support the development of mathematical learning disability (MLD). Following hypotheses were tested in the thesis: a) domain general deficit, the deficit is primarily located in the domain general systems such as the working memory, b) number sense deficit, the deficit is located in the innate approximate number system (ANS), c) numerosity coding deficit, the deficit is located to a exact number representation system, d) access deficit, the deficit is in the mapping between symbols and the innate number representational system (e.
